HR 7914 · 94th Congress · Social Welfare
A bill to amend part D of title IV of the Social Security Act to facilitate the administration of the provisions authorizing garnishment of Federal wages to enforce child support and alimony obligations.

Stipulates that legal process brought for the garnishment of wages of a Federal employee pursuant to the child support provisions of the Aid to Families with Dependent Children program shall not be effective against the United States until 10 working days after it is delivered by certified mail to the head of the Federal agency by which the moneys involved are payable. Directs the President, Comptroller General, and the Director of the Administrative Office of the United States courts to prescribe regulations covering the garnishment of such wages.…
